The wage range is from $56 to $59 per hour, reflective of experience. Hourly wage is determined based on the candidate’s work experience and will be discussed during the interview process.

Your Role:

  • Appropriately assess, plan, implement and evaluate services for patient care

  • Perform all aspects of clinical preventative hygiene services including scaling, root planning, polishing, topical fluoride, pit and fissure sealants and whitening to patients

  • Serve as an oral health educator by introducing new preventative techniques and counselling

  • Establish andretainpatient loyalty by delivering a tailored experience based on the patients’ expectations, while consistentlymaintainingethical and professionalbehaviour

About You:

  • Completion of a Dental Hygiene Diploma or Degreeisrequired

  • Current registration as a Dental Hygienist in good standing with the provincial regulatory bodyisrequired

  • Valid CPR certificationisrequired
